Step-by-step explanation:
So we need to find the volume of the inner sphere. Try to picture the coconut as a circle with another circle inside of it. We know that the bigger circle is 55 inches wide, and the distance between the circumferences of the circles is 11 inches. that means the inner circle is 55 - 2(11) inches wide. This is because we have 11 inches of coconut meat on either side of the inner circle.
55 - 2(11) = 33 inches
The radius is half of the diameter, so r = 16.5 inches.
Now just use the formaula V = 
V = (4/3) * 3.14 * (16.5)^3
V = 18816.57 in^3
